# S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0
# SPDX-FileCopyrightText: Copyright contributors to the vLLM project
import asyncio
import os
import openai # use the official client for correctness check
import pytest
import pytest_asyncio
from tests.utils import RemoteOpenAIServer
MODEL_NAME = "ibm-research/PowerMoE-3b"
DP_SIZE = os.getenv("DP_SIZE", "1")
@pytest.fixture(scope="module")
def default_server_args():
return [
# use half precision for speed and memory savings in CI environment
"--dtype",
"bfloat16",
"--max-model-len",
"2048",
"--max-num-seqs",
"128",
"--enforce-eager",
"--api-server-count",
"4",
"--data_parallel_size",
DP_SIZE,
]
@pytest.fixture(scope="module")
def server(default_server_args):
with RemoteOpenAIServer(MODEL_NAME, default_server_args) as remote_server:
yield remote_server
@pytest_asyncio.fixture
async def client(server):
async with server.get_async_client() as async_client:
yield async_client
@pytest.mark.asyncio
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
"model_name",
[MODEL_NAME],
)
async def test_single_completion(client: openai.AsyncOpenAI,
model_name: str) -> None:
async def make_request():
completion = await client.completions.create(
model=model_name,
prompt="Hello, my name is",
max_tokens=10,
temperature=1.0)
assert completion.id is not None
assert completion.choices is not None and len(completion.choices) == 1
choice = completion.choices[0]
# The exact number of tokens can vary slightly with temperature=1.0,
# so we check for a reasonable minimum length.
assert len(choice.text) >= 1
# Finish reason might not always be 'length' if the model finishes early
# or due to other reasons, especially with high temperature.
# So, we'll accept 'length' or 'stop'.
assert choice.finish_reason in ("length", "stop")
# Token counts can also vary, so we check they are positive.
assert completion.usage.completion_tokens > 0
assert completion.usage.prompt_tokens > 0
assert completion.usage.total_tokens > 0
return completion
# Test single request
result = await make_request()
assert result is not None
await asyncio.sleep(0.5)
# Send two bursts of requests
num_requests = 100
tasks = [make_request() for _ in range(num_requests)]
results = await asyncio.gather(*tasks)
assert len(results) == num_requests
assert all(completion is not None for completion in results)
await asyncio.sleep(0.5)
tasks = [make_request() for _ in range(num_requests)]
results = await asyncio.gather(*tasks)
assert len(results) == num_requests
assert all(completion is not None for completion in results)
@pytest.mark.asyncio
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
"model_name",
[MODEL_NAME],
)
async def test_completion_streaming(client: openai.AsyncOpenAI,
model_name: str) -> None:
prompt = "What is an LLM?"
async def make_streaming_request():
# Perform a non-streaming request to get the expected full output
single_completion = await client.completions.create(
model=model_name,
prompt=prompt,
max_tokens=5,
temperature=0.0,
)
single_output = single_completion.choices[0].text
# Perform the streaming request
stream = await client.completions.create(model=model_name,
prompt=prompt,
max_tokens=5,
temperature=0.0,
stream=True)
chunks: list[str] = []
finish_reason_count = 0
last_chunk = None
async for chunk in stream:
chunks.append(chunk.choices[0].text)
if chunk.choices[0].finish_reason is not None:
finish_reason_count += 1
last_chunk = chunk # Keep track of the last chunk
# finish reason should only return in the last block for OpenAI API
assert finish_reason_count == 1, (
"Finish reason should appear exactly once.")
assert last_chunk is not None, (
"Stream should have yielded at least one chunk.")
assert last_chunk.choices[
0].finish_reason == "length", "Finish reason should be 'length'."
# Check that the combined text matches the non-streamed version.
assert "".join(
chunks
) == single_output, "Streamed output should match non-streamed output."
return True # Indicate success for this request
# Test single request
result = await make_streaming_request()
assert result is not None
await asyncio.sleep(0.5)
# Send two bursts of requests
num_requests = 100
tasks = [make_streaming_request() for _ in range(num_requests)]
results = await asyncio.gather(*tasks)
assert len(
results
) == num_requests, f"Expected {num_requests} results, got {len(results)}"
assert all(results), "Not all streaming requests completed successfully."
await asyncio.sleep(0.5)
tasks = [make_streaming_request() for _ in range(num_requests)]
results = await asyncio.gather(*tasks)
assert len(
results
) == num_requests, f"Expected {num_requests} results, got {len(results)}"
assert all(results), "Not all streaming requests completed successfully."
